Job summary
A leading medical services provider is expanding its physician panel and is seeking board-certified Neurosurgeons for a fully remote opportunity in medical record reviews. This role allows you to work flexibly, accepting or declining cases based on your availability. Responsibilities include reviewing medical records, providing expert opinions, and delivering written reports without face-to-face interaction. Ideal candidates will have strong analytical skills and communication abilities, and a background in medical record reviews is preferred.
Qualifications
Board certification in Neurosurgery required.
Prior experience with medical record reviews, IMEs, or peer reviews preferred.
Strong analytical skills and excellent written communication abilities.
Responsibilities
Thorough review and analysis of prepared medical records.
Provide expert, advisory-only opinions regarding the claimant's current condition.
Respond to clinical questions to support claims management.
Deliver clear, well-supported written reports within an expected turnaround time of 5 days.
No face-to-face interaction with claimants.
